I am now the overly too proud father of the Fastest SVX that is to remain naturally aspirated... I got to run out to Atco for one last blast down the strip with the old girl before she goes to her new home and WOW was I impressed... The best time I could throw down was 14.534 @95.33mph... Yes this just beat out PhastSVX's time of 14.59 but I have my own excusses as to why. 1st off, I could not get a great launch out of her without spinning all 4's due to the fact that I cannot drive around the water they spray for burnouts... My clutch also doesn't seem to be able to handle the new found power and it slips some when changing gears... I think with the a firmer clutch and now water.. I could have run a 14.4 or 14.3 with my highest trap of the day being at 96.2mph :eek: Anyway... I will see if I can break my own record again someday with the 6mt once I start modding it again...Below is a picture of the time slip I am car #3994
